Evaluation of the relationship between lifestyle factors and vitamin D levels in healthcare workers

Aim This study evaluated the effects of lifestyle habits on serum 25(OH)D levels and the prevalence of vitamin D deficiency among healthcare workers. Methods In this retrospective study, laboratory and demographic data of 204 healthcare workers who attended the Internal Medicine outpatient clinic between January 1, 2023, and January 1, 2024, and had serum vitamin D levels measured were analyzed. Lifestyle factors, including sun exposure, clothing style, physical activity, smoking, and alcohol use, were assessed using a researcher-designed questionnaire. Categorical variables were expressed as frequencies and percentages, and continuous variables as means or medians according to data distribution. Statistical analyses were performed. Results The mean serum 25(OH)D level was 7.31 ± 5.41 ng/mL, indicating marked vitamin D deficiency. Vitamin D levels were slightly higher in males than in females; however, the difference was not statistically significant (P > .05). Participants who dressed according to seasonal conditions and those with daily sun exposure exceeding 30 minutes had significantly higher vitamin D levels (P < .05). No significant associations were observed between vitamin D levels and profession, mode of transportation, or frequency of physical activity (P > .05). Conclusion Vitamin D deficiency was highly prevalent among healthcare workers. Adequate sun exposure and clothing that allows skin exposure positively influence serum vitamin D levels, highlighting the need for increased awareness and preventive strategies. Further multicenter prospective studies are needed to clarify the relationship between lifestyle factors and vitamin D status.
